Output 631fc9c3665b29e5a7ec02391c539a8e9bc040cbe19a6e7ef56b63f8dbbbbd54:1

value
22349
script pubkey
OP_0 OP_PUSHBYTES_20 bcfbafd2b2faa486e9b7226195b195584540dc17
address
bc1qhna6l54jl2jgd6dhyfsetvv4tpz5phqhudrxt0
transaction
631fc9c3665b29e5a7ec02391c539a8e9bc040cbe19a6e7ef56b63f8dbbbbd54
confirmations
2601
spent
true